Musical-visual Project executed by Proac ICMS 2011 cultural incentive programme, sponsored by Lupo. Each comics painting was produced by SOPA using techniques of craft recycled paper collage, the most meaningful cultural points of São Paulo city were mentioned, taking music as a reference. The exhibition, with its soundtrack composed and performed by SOPA, premiered in Buenos Aires, where the duo settled down as its artistic residence to create the exhibition’s second part, presented in São Paulo, with references to the Argentinian capital. The part of the story related to São Paulo city (paulistana) was expanded into X-Sampa Mural format, exposed in several public spaces in São Paulo, with live soundtrack performances.
